7. 点击“Export project”按钮,开始导出您的Group。 导出过程可能需要一段时间,具体时间取决于Group中包含的项目的数量和大小。 8. 导出完成后,您将获得一个存储导出数据的tar文件。您可以将此文件下载到本地机器上或将其保存到云存储服务中。 9. 现在,您可以将导出文件拷贝到新的GitLab实例中。确保您已经具有...
if groupName == '': url = "http://%s/api/v4/projects?private_token=%s&per_page=1000&order_by=name" % (gitlabAddr, gitlabPrivateToken) else: url = "http://%s/api/v3/groups/%s/projects?private_token=%s&per_page=1000&order_by=name" % (gitlabAddr, groupName, gitlabPrivateToken)...
git clone <群组项目的URL> “` 2. 创建新的群组(可选) 如果需要将项目复制到一个新的群组,可以在 GitLab 上创建新的群组。 在GitLab 界面上的顶部导航栏,点击 “New group”,然后按照提示创建新的群组。 3. 创建新的仓库 在新的群组中,点击 “New project”,填写新的仓库的名称和描述,并选择合适的可见...
gitlab如何实现批量clone仓库 环境 windows环境 步骤一 需要有一个gitLab的group id,使用这个group id去查询组中的所有项目。示例: http://gitlab域名/api/v4/groups/你的groupid 你会得到一个json字符串。需要从中获取http_url_to_repo或ssh_url_to_repo字段的值,此处以http_url_to_repo为例。 步骤二 如何...
由于Gitlab 系统是企业内部私有代码仓库,所有用户都是由管理员创建,并不需要注册功能,因此我们需要关闭此功能: 去掉此选项保存即可。再次登录就没有注册功能啦 八.Gitlab仓库管理 GitLab 是通过组(group)的概念来统一管理仓库(project)和用户(user),通过创建组,在组下再创建仓库,再将用户加入到组,从而实现用户与仓...
Gitlab解决了这个问题, 可以在上面创建免费的私人repo。 二、gitlab server搭建过程 [root@gitlab ~]# yum install -y curl openssh-server openssh-clients postfix cronie policycoreutils-python //10.x以后开始依赖policycoreutils-python [root@gitlab ~]# systemctl start postfix ...
10)clone 在GitLab中已有项目 为演示,先删除刚刚在eclipse里创建的GitPro1项目 客户端Eclipse上,打开git Repositories视图。点击 . clone a git Repository.输入信息后点击next,我们会看到服务端git库的分支master出现了Next点击Finish. 我们的clone就完成了。现在...
Gitlab 的v13.0之前,只能在兼容版本的Gitlab之间实现导入导出。 例如Gitlab v12.10导出的项目只能导入到版本号为v11.70到v12.10的Gitlab,具体参考: 从GitLab 13.0开始,GitLab可以导入从不同的GitLab部署中导出的包,仅限于之前的两个GitLab小版本,例如: # 速率限制 # 导出限制 在项目导出时,不是所有的数据都会...
现在让我们先来clone一下我们的项目 使用下面的命令就可以直接clone, gitclonegit@gitlab.com:fe-test1/git-demo.git 首次clone的时候会让你输入用户名和密码.,如果你不知道自己的密码是多少了,可以Edit profiles->password当中修改。下图展示即位clone成功。
1)克隆远程仓库数据到本地 Clone 2)在本地工作区对文件修改后提交到暂存区 Add 3)多次修改后将暂存区文件提交到本地代码仓库 Commit 4)本地Git仓库将数据提交到远程 Push Git配置 在本地新建一个文件夹,输入命令git init,该命令会初始化本地仓库。打开隐藏文件浏览就能看见在该文件夹下多了一个.git文件夹 ...